Electric scooters provide a variety of advantages that contribute to their growing popularity. Below are some of the essential benefits:
1. Eco-Friendly
Electric scooters produce zero emissions, making them a greener alternative to traditional gasoline-powered lorries. By choosing e-scooters, users can add to minimizing air contamination in urban areas.
2. Cost-Effective
While the preliminary purchase cost of an electrical scooter can be substantial, the long-lasting savings are substantial. Users save money on fuel, parking fees, and upkeep expenses compared to vehicles or mass transit.
3. Hassle-free and Portable
Electric scooters are light-weight and portable, making it easy for riders to browse congested areas and easily store their scooters when not in usage. Lots of models fold for easy transportation.
4. Time-Saving
In thick urban areas, electrical scooters can assist riders prevent traffic congestion and reach their locations quicker. Studies suggest that e-scooter users can take a trip at typical speeds of 15 miles per hour, making them competitive with vehicles in other words range journeys.
5. Boosted Mobility
Mobility electric scooters are particularly helpful for people with restricted mobility. They supply a means of transport that is accessible and easy to use, expanding alternatives for those who may deal with strolling cross countries.
Types of Mobility Electric Scooters
Not all electric scooters are produced equal. Depending upon the meant use and rider needs, there are a number of types offered:
1. Commuter Scooters
Designed for day-to-day usage, commuter scooters are generally lightweight and have a good series of 15-30 miles on a single charge. Easy to use functions like removable batteries and integrated lights are also typical.
2. Off-Road Scooters
These scooters are constructed to handle rough surfaces, with bigger wheels and robust suspension systems. Off-road electrical scooters are best for those who delight in adventure and exploring nature tracks.
3. Efficiency Scooters
Performance scooters are developed for speed and dexterity, typically geared up with effective motors that can reach speeds of 30 miles per hour or more. They are suitable for skilled riders looking for an adrenaline rush.
4. Folding Scooters
Folding scooters are perfect for city settings, as they can be quickly collapsed and brought on public transport or kept in small spaces. They are normally light-weight and simple to maneuver.

Features to Consider When Buying an Electric Scooter
When purchasing a mobility electric scooter, prospective purchasers ought to consider several crucial functions:
Range: The distance the scooter can take a trip on a single charge. Search for designs that fulfill your daily travelling requirements. Weight Limit: Check the optimum weight capacity to make sure the scooter can securely accommodate the rider. Speed: Consider the maximum speed; for city environments, 15-20 miles per hour is typically sufficient. Battery Type: Lithium-ion batteries supply the best performance, but consider charging time and life expectancy. Braking System: Effective brakes are crucial for security. Try to find designs with both electronic and mechanical brakes. Q1: Are electric scooters safe?
A1: Yes, electrical scooters can be safe when used responsibly. It is very important to use helmets and follow local traffic laws.

Q2: What is the typical life expectancy of an electrical scooter?
A2: With appropriate care, an excellent quality electrical scooter can last between 3 to 5 years, depending upon use and upkeep.
Q3: How long does it require to charge an electric scooter?
A3: Charging time varies by model, however a lot of scooters take between 4 to 8 hours for a full charge.
Q4: Do I need a license to ride an electric scooter?

Q5: Can electrical scooters be utilized in the rain?
A5: While numerous scooters are developed to be waterproof, it's best to prevent riding in heavy rain to prevent damage.
